I make an internship in Bucharest.

On last wednesday I arrived on "Aeroportul Internaţional Henri Coandă Bucureşti". Someone waited for me and took me to my company. Now I can use the shuttlebus for my way home or to work. It seems to be normal in Bucharest that companies have a travel-service.

At lunch time we go to a supermarket for buying some drink and food. On the way we saw a woman who's pet is a cow. :-) She walked along the road with a leash on a cow.

On Saturday I visited the town.
I walked along the Unirii Boulevard and the Calea Victoriei.

Here is it very hot and I have to drink a lot.

I don't want to drive by car, because here are a lot of cars. They drive where and how fast they want. The streets are big and a red traffic light is just a suggestion.

I enjoy my journey and hope in the next weeks I can see more from Bucharest.
